Top Ethical and Reputable Alternatives:

The following brands are known for their commitment to quality, transparency, and often natural or ethically sourced ingredients, making them suitable choices for conscientious consumers.

Always double-check specific product ingredient lists for your personal dietary or ethical requirements, as formulations can vary.

  • Proraso (Classic Italian Grooming)

    Amazon

    • Key Features: A timeless Italian brand specializing in shaving and beard care. Known for its refreshing, natural formulations and classic barbershop feel. Offers pre-shave creams, shaving creams, aftershaves, and beard products.
    • Pros: Long-standing reputation, high-quality natural ingredients, wide availability, often very affordable. Free from parabens, silicones, mineral oil, and artificial colors.
    • Cons: Primarily focused on shaving and beard care, less comprehensive for general hair styling beyond traditional needs.

  • Aesop (Skincare & Grooming)

    • Key Features: A highly respected Australian brand known for its plant-based, laboratory-grown ingredients and minimalist aesthetic. Offers a range of hair care, body care, and skincare products.
    • Pros: High-quality botanical extracts, sophisticated and subtle scents, commitment to sustainable practices, transparent ingredient lists.
    • Cons: Premium price point, not explicitly marketed as “halal” but generally uses plant-based ingredients. always verify specific product lists.
  • Dr. Bronner’s (Multi-Purpose & Ethical)

    • Key Features: Renowned for its organic, fair trade, and environmentally responsible practices. Their castile soaps can be used for hair, body, and even household cleaning. Offers ethical alternatives to many chemical-laden products.
    • Pros: Certified organic, fair trade, cruelty-free, highly versatile, transparent about ingredients, strong ethical mission.
    • Cons: Simpler formulations might not offer specialized benefits (e.g., strong hold styling). scents are often natural and might not appeal to all.
  • 18.21 Man Made (Barbershop Inspired)

    • Key Features: Inspired by Prohibition-era speakeasy lounges, this brand offers premium, masculine-scented grooming products including hair pomades, body washes, and beard balms. Known for “Sweet Tobacco” scent.
    • Pros: Unique, appealing scents, high-quality formulations, often sulfate and paraben-free, good performance for styling.
    • Cons: While the “tobacco” scent is artificial, some might prefer fragrance-free. check individual product ingredient lists for specific concerns.
